Should my dog or cat eat a gluten-free or grain-free diet?

As for gluten, dogs and cats don’t have celiac disease. Gluten is a great source of protein in commercial diets.

Grain-free diets are now being seen as a huge no-no. Veterinary cardiologists are seeing a large rise in cases of cardiomyopathy in breeds that don’t usually have it. Upon exploration, those dogs are mostly on grain-free diets. There is still uncertainty if the diets lack something by excluding meat, or if the cause is something added in the substitutes (like legumes).

Food allergies are typically allergies to the protein sources, not the grains.

I really hate the commercials for grain-free diets that start out about dogs in the wild…. YOUR DOG IS NOT IN THE WILD. Your dog is not a wolf. Your dog has evolved over tens of thousands of years to be a domestic animal. Besides, the first thing the wolf eats is the rabbit’s intestines… full of grains.
